Transaction 3e8440f304ce2ab57b3196736ffbb86cd50b49c28fe05090085de0a2018f46ce

1 Input
2 Outputs
  • 3e8440f304ce2ab57b3196736ffbb86cd50b49c28fe05090085de0a2018f46ce:0
  • value  6112101
    address  3MTHfzcEjDujGAtWwrVZuSvCG1NuUHVwGg
  • 3e8440f304ce2ab57b3196736ffbb86cd50b49c28fe05090085de0a2018f46ce:1
  • value  4759234
    address  114BiDoptPV5DgU8zTNKDR64Cqq2roHvCS